Blue Phlox Seeds - Drummondii Nana Compacta Beauty
The annual Phlox Drummondii (Drummondii Nana Compacta Beauty Blue) is excellent for containers, borders or mix with other flowers. These popular flowers make beautiful cut flowers - they last long in a vase. The cluster blooms are trumpet-shaped with a short, narrow tube. The leaves are soft, hairy and sticky. For an abundant flower display the following year, allow Phlox Drummondii to reseed. Blue Phlox prefer afternoon shade in hot summer climates, and can tolerate some hot and dry conditions in summer. However, annual Phlox do also well even in moisture.
